Got back last night from 2 lovely weeks staying at the Kosmas Apartments for the 3rd year running. Our flights ending up being on time but bizarre. On the way out from Birmingham on 22nd July we didn't fly Small Planet but Grand Cru and with complementary ham and cheese toasties and a soft drink....the nicest toasties I've had on a flight. On checking in last night at Corfu Airport we were told we would be flying with Cyprus Airways instead of Small Planet. Took of on time and I have to say it's one of the nicest European flights we've ever taken.....complementary 3 cours dinner, soft drinks and tea or coffee. I don't know who's paying for the change of airline but I'm not complaining.
As ever our time in Roda was great and it's amazing how the restaurant and bar owners remember you.....really heartwarming. Loved the new restaurant El Mar but I do hope they take on another pair of hands as demand was outstripping staff.....but that's not a complaint as the food is delicious and we highly recommend it.
Visited Pantokrator by car and then took a drive to the Donkey Sanctuary which was a lovely experience.
The festival in the village was great and I'm so glad we got to see it. The girl singer with the band was our morning bar/kitchen lady at Kosmas....she's working some very long hours....and the PA and band system is run by George who owns our apartments.
Had some lovely evenings in Crusoes and managed to come third in two of the quiz nights........granted there wasn't a huge amount of competition.
I actually thought the mosquitos were less than the last couple of years but I was dosed up with yeast tablets and hosed down with repellent!!!! The little blighters usually love me!!
I thought there wasn't a great deal of change in food/drink prices and we ate out every day........I am a cook by profession so that's my holiday perk!
